MATA Festival Returns to Brooklyn for 27th Year Exploring Music, Mysticism And Identity

The MATA Festival showcases emerging composers and legendary artists, exploring themes of ancestry, identity, and science fiction.
This year's festival features 18 composers selected from over 300 submissions.

Still casting a spell: Broadcast's 20 best songs ranked!

Originally a limited-edition sold on tour, and the band's last release before singer Trish Keenan's death in 2011, mini-album Mother Is the Milky Way was more about fragmentary sound collages than songs. However, In Here the World Begins, floating Keenan's vocals over a murky, slowed-down tape loop, showcases a strange and compelling power, underscoring the band's unique approach during their final years.
